China's Xiaojiaotian Sichuan Restaurant in Singapore

Bullfrog with pickled chili

I saw signs for this place at City Square Mall bragging about being the "No. 1 Seller of Pickled Chilli Bullfrogs in China" (180 Kitchener Road #04-37, 6312-4698). I knew exactly what I was going to order then, even though the menu featured a number of Sichuan items like laziji that I wanted to try too.

The frog legs tasted like proverbial chicken but lighter and firmer, and was also like eating crab in that one had to slowly work through the little bones. The yellow chili peppers tasted like Chicago sport peppers, while the broth was sour from the pickles. It wasn't super spicy, but apparently they toned it down for local tastes.
